Master Bond, Inc. NASA Low Outgassing, Thermally Conductive Two Part Silicone MasterSil 972TC-LO

Description
MasterSil 972TC-LO is capable of transferring heat with a thermal conductivity of 7-9 BTU•in/ft²•hr•°F [1.01-1.30 W/(m•K)], while retaining superior dielectric properties. It bonds well to a wide variety of substrates, including metals, composites, glass, ceramics as well as many types of rubbers and plastics. This addition cured system does not require air for cross-linking. It features low shrinkage upon curing even in thick or wide cross sections. MasterSil 972TC-LO has very good flexibility and high elongation. It can withstand aggressive thermal cycling as well as thermal and mechanical shock. This moderate viscosity system passes the rigorous requirements for low outgassing per ASTM E595 specifications. It is particularly well suited for use in vacuum environments as well as applications in the aerospace, electronic, opto-electronic and specialty OEM industries. MasterSil 972TC-LO is 100% solid and has a white color.
